Replace a single dash with a double dash for options that have more than a single letter. llvm-bolt-wrapper.py has special treatment for output options such as "-o" and "-w" causing issues when a single dash is used, e.g. for "-write-dwp". The wrapper can be fixed as well, but using a double dash has other advantages as well. Reviewed By: rafauler Differential Revision: https://reviews.llvm.org/D127538
